<p><P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To wholly restrain the deterioration in emission and drivability, by determining abnormality of an oxygen gas sensor having a catalyst downstream side Z output characteristic, in air-fuel ratio forced setting control for determining the deterioration in a three way catalyst. <P>SOLUTION: The control target air-fuel ratio on the catalyst upstream side is set to the preset lean air-fuel ratio abyfLean or the preset rich air-fuel ratio abyfRich for determining the deterioration in the three way catalyst provided in an exhaust passage. The O2 sensor detects that the air-fuel ratio on the catalyst downstream side is switched to lean or rich by straddling a threshold value from the initial rich or lean air-fuel ratio, and determines the existence of the deterioration in the three way catalyst on the basis of this fact. At this time, a rate of changeΔv/Δt of a detecting value of the oxygen gas sensor is investigated, and when the detecting value of the oxygen gas sensor indicates a stable value without straddling the threshold value, its value is detected, and the air-fuel ratio forced setting control is immediately stopped as failure of the oxygen gas sensor.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2006,JPO&NCIPI</p> |
